Makana Local Municipality invited Community Work Programme workers and Ward Committee members to a meeting at the Extension 9 Community Hall from the following wards: 1, 2, 3, 5, 6, 11, today 26 February 2025.
This follows a meeting on Wednesday, 19 February in which Makana Local Municipality Executive Mayor and the Office of the Speaker held a important meeting with participants of the Expanded Public Works Programme (EPWP), and Community Works Programme (CWP) from across Makana Local Municipality.
The purpose of the meeting was to reinforce the reporting lines of CWP workers. In that meeting the Executive Mayor of Makana Municipality Cllr Yandiswa Vara assured all workers that quarterly meetings would be held to address the state of the municipality, including service delivery challenges, as well as to outline ongoing and upcoming projects.
The Executive Mayor also highlighted the need for a plan to upskill the youth that's participating in these programmes. "Many have qualifications but struggle to find employment, and it is crucial to equip them with practical skills in their fields of study to enhance their employability."
The meeting marked the beginning of a stronger collaboration between the municipality and the CWP. These meetings are part of the municipality's programme to give direction to these government funded employment initiatives. More meetings will be held going forward.
